Premium backpack brand deuter has been announced as an official Major Partner of Kendal Mountain Festival 2025. This partnership brings an action-packed schedule of events, discussions, and product showcases to the festival’s line-up. Following the recent unveiling of the revised Attack backpack, set for release in Spring/Summer 2026, deuter will sponsor the festival’s popular ‘Bike Night’. The partnership aims to communicate deuter’s commitment to adventure and sustainability with the UK outdoor community. Moreover, these values will be discussed during the Basecamp sessions held on the deuter Bothy stage.
The festival features several highlights from some of deuter’s leading ambassadors, including film screenings and panel discussions. Kathryn Roberts discusses her life as a female mountaineer and her summit of Mont Blanc. Meanwhile, Hannah Mitchell and Samantha Jagger then discuss the challenges of being a female mountaineer, focusing on their expedition to Tajikistan. Finally, for 2025, deuter will sponsor the festival’s popular ‘Bike Night,’ featuring an on-stage interview with professional mountain biker Rachel Atherton.
The European Outdoor Conservation Association (EOCA), British Mountaineering Council (BMC) and Trash Free Trails will also hold a panel discussion on the deuter Bothy stage. They will discuss adventure leading to activism.

deuter will also showcase several new Spring/Summer 2026 products. Highlights include the new Guide, featuring enhanced comfort. It will also have improved load transfer via its optimised Alpine back system. The Attack debuts the exclusive, 100% recyclable and biodegradable deuter x RE ZRO full back protector. This offers superior protection. The new Futura line offers enhanced comfort through innovations like Softedge Shoulder Straps, new back system meshes, and an enlarged lumbar mesh for stability. Furthermore, this comfort is improved by the VariSlide back length adjustment system featured on the Futura Pro. It allows for a perfect and customised fit.
